The Joey Houck Band

With his feet firmly rooted in the blues, Joey Houck brings youthful vigor and excitement to a live show that takes his audiences back to a different place in time. His guitar work evokes Stevie Ray, Hendrix and Santana, and his soulful vocals are reminiscent of artists like the great Johnnie Taylor.
Like Lance Lopez and Ray LaMontagne, Joey is part of a new generation of musicians blending some of the best classic genres of American music. His 2019 album Island Daydream showcases his many influences, including compositions that are very Robin Trower-esque, with deep grooves, earnest lyrics, and catchy rock riffs.
Originally from Kodiak, Alaska, Joey has performed extensively across the United States. In 2019, he relocated to Louisiana, both to work with and learn from the cultural torchbearers in New Orleans, and to establish a home base for his band. Joey currently performs regularly at nightclubs and breweries across the Gulf Coast as well as at New Orleans venues that include Club 30/90, Southport Hall, Santos, the Rivershack, Midnight Revival, Whiskey Bayou, the Drifter, and Dean Zucchero’s Blues in the Bierhalle series.
